type ExternalKey ¶
type ExternalKey struct { pulumi.CustomResourceState // Name of CMK. The name can only contain English letters, numbers, underscore and hyphen '-'. The first character must be // a letter or number. Alias pulumi.StringOutput `pulumi:"alias"` // Description of CMK. The maximum is 1024 bytes. Description pulumi.StringPtrOutput `pulumi:"description"` // Specify whether to archive key. Default value is `false`. This field is conflict with `is_enabled`, valid when key_state // is `Enabled`, `Disabled`, `Archived`. IsArchived pulumi.BoolPtrOutput `pulumi:"isArchived"` // Specify whether to enable key. Default value is `false`. This field is conflict with `is_archived`, valid when key_state // is `Enabled`, `Disabled`, `Archived`. IsEnabled pulumi.BoolPtrOutput `pulumi:"isEnabled"` // The base64-encoded key material encrypted with the public_key. For regions using the national secret version, the length // of the imported key material is required to be 128 bits, and for regions using the FIPS version, the length of the // imported key material is required to be 256 bits. KeyMaterialBase64 pulumi.StringPtrOutput `pulumi:"keyMaterialBase64"` // State of CMK. KeyState pulumi.StringOutput `pulumi:"keyState"` // Duration in days after which the key is deleted after destruction of the resource, must be between 7 and 30 days. // Defaults to 7 days. PendingDeleteWindowInDays pulumi.IntPtrOutput `pulumi:"pendingDeleteWindowInDays"` // Tags of CMK. Tags pulumi.MapOutput `pulumi:"tags"` // This value means the effective timestamp of the key material, 0 means it does not expire. Need to be greater than the // current timestamp, the maximum support is 2147443200. ValidTo pulumi.IntPtrOutput `pulumi:"validTo"` // The algorithm for encrypting key material. Available values include `RSAES_PKCS1_V1_5`, `RSAES_OAEP_SHA_1` and // `RSAES_OAEP_SHA_256`. Default value is `RSAES_PKCS1_V1_5`. WrappingAlgorithm pulumi.StringPtrOutput `pulumi:"wrappingAlgorithm"` }

type KmsKey ¶
type KmsKey struct { pulumi.CustomResourceState // Name of CMK. The name can only contain English letters, numbers, underscore and hyphen '-'. The first character must be // a letter or number. Alias pulumi.StringOutput `pulumi:"alias"` // Description of CMK. The maximum is 1024 bytes. Description pulumi.StringPtrOutput `pulumi:"description"` // Specify whether to archive key. Default value is `false`. This field is conflict with `is_enabled`, valid when key_state // is `Enabled`, `Disabled`, `Archived`. IsArchived pulumi.BoolPtrOutput `pulumi:"isArchived"` // Specify whether to enable key. Default value is `false`. This field is conflict with `is_archived`, valid when key_state // is `Enabled`, `Disabled`, `Archived`. IsEnabled pulumi.BoolPtrOutput `pulumi:"isEnabled"` // Specify whether to enable key rotation, valid when key_usage is `ENCRYPT_DECRYPT`. Default value is `false`. KeyRotationEnabled pulumi.BoolPtrOutput `pulumi:"keyRotationEnabled"` // State of CMK. KeyState pulumi.StringOutput `pulumi:"keyState"` // Usage of CMK. Available values include `ENCRYPT_DECRYPT`, `ASYMMETRIC_DECRYPT_RSA_2048`, `ASYMMETRIC_DECRYPT_SM2`, // `ASYMMETRIC_SIGN_VERIFY_SM2`, `ASYMMETRIC_SIGN_VERIFY_RSA_2048`, `ASYMMETRIC_SIGN_VERIFY_ECC`. Default value is // `ENCRYPT_DECRYPT`. KeyUsage pulumi.StringPtrOutput `pulumi:"keyUsage"` // Duration in days after which the key is deleted after destruction of the resource, must be between 7 and 30 days. // Defaults to 7 days. PendingDeleteWindowInDays pulumi.IntPtrOutput `pulumi:"pendingDeleteWindowInDays"` // Tags of CMK. Tags pulumi.MapOutput `pulumi:"tags"` }
